Find the gateway address — On Windows, Mac, or Linux you can view the default gateway in network settings or with a simple command. Finding the Router's Address (Mac): Make sure your computer is connected to the Internet. Type your modem’s IP address into the browser’s address bar and hit Enter. Connect to your modem: find a device that’s already connected to your modem, like a laptop, and open a web browser. Enter your login credentials: To access your modem’s settings, you’ll need to authenticate as an authorized user.
